A very experienced woman cyclist was killed on a road she knew well when she hit a trailer under a narrow railway bridge, an inquest was told.
Pat Appleton regularly rode for pleasure with the Stroud Valleys Cycling Club and was taking part in a non-competitive 100 kilometre time trial between Bristol and Epney when she died.See the full content of this document
